Weather in June

June, the first month of the summer in La Enea, is still a warm month, with an average temperature fluctuating between 29.7°C (85.5°F) and 24.2°C (75.6°F).

Temperature

Welcoming June, La Enea notes an average high-temperature of a warm 29.7°C (85.5°F), nearly consistent with May's 30.5°C (86.9°F). In La Enea, the June nights cool down to an average low of 24.2°C (75.6°F).

Heat index

In June, the average heat index is computed to be a sweltering 38°C (100.4°F). Adopt special protective actions against heat exhaustion and heat cramps. Long-duration activity risks heatstroke.
It is emphasized that the heat index's values are meant for shaded zones with mild winds. Under direct sunshine, the heat index values might be elevated by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'felt air temperature' or 'apparent temperature', unifies temperature and humidity readings to offer a comprehensive feel of warmth. The individual's temperature perception can be influenced by numerous factors such as metabolic variations, physical activity, and clothing. Keep in mind that direct sunshine exposure can amplify the weather's effects, possibly increasing the heat index by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are of high significance for children. Youths are typically more endangered than adults since they usually sweat less. Their larger skin surface concerning their smaller bodies and higher heat production due to activity further adds to their vulnerability.
To cool down, the human body relies on perspiration, a process where excessive heat is eliminated as sweat evaporates. When relative humidity is heightened, it slows the rate of evaporation, thereby decreasing the body's ability to shed heat and creating a sensation of overheating. Excessive heat gain, when not shed effectively by the body, can result in increasing body temperatures and related hazards.

Humidity

The average relative humidity in June in La Enea is 84%.

Rainfall

In La Enea, during June, the rain falls for 27.1 days and regularly aggregates up to 170mm (6.69") of precipitation. Throughout the year, there are 261.2 rainfall days, and 1359mm (53.5") of precipitation is accumulated.

Daylight

The month with the longest days is June, with an average of 12h and 36min of daylight.
On the first day of June in La Enea, sunrise is at 06:02 and sunset at 18:35.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 06:07 and sunset at 18:42 EST.

Sunshine

The average sunshine in June in La Enea is 7.9h.

UV index

January through September, November and December, with an average maximum UV index of 7, are months with the highest UV index in La Enea, Panama. A UV Index of 6 to 7 symbolizes a high health vulnerability from unprotected exposure to Sun's UV rays for average individuals.
